Classified Definitive by ClinGen Aminoacidopathy GCEP on 29/06/2020 - https://search.clinicalgenome.org/CCID:004163
Reported in >5 unrelated probands with manifestations of hyperammonemia and hyperargininemia. It is an inborn error of L-arginine metabolism.
Two knock out mouse models have been conducted attesting to the LoF mechanism of disease.
